Understanding Google Ads
Google Ads is an intent-based advertising platform. Your ads appear when users actively search for a product or service.
Key Features of Google Ads
-
Search Ads (text ads on Google search results)
-
Display Ads (banner ads across websites)
-
YouTube Ads
-
Shopping Ads
-
Performance Max campaigns
Why Google Ads Works
Google Ads targets users already looking for a solution, making it ideal for high-intent lead generation.
Example searches:
-
“SEO agency in Chicago”
-
“website development services near me”
-
“Google Ads expert USA”
These users are closer to making a decision, which often results in higher conversion rates.

Google Ads vs Facebook Ads: ROI Comparison

| Factor | Google Ads | Facebook Ads |
|---|---|---|
| User Intent | High (search-based) | Medium (interest-based) |
| Cost Per Click | Higher | Lower |
| Conversion Rate | High | Moderate |
| Brand Awareness | Medium | High |
| Lead Quality | High-intent | Mixed |
| Best For | Direct leads & sales | Awareness & retargeting |
Which Platform Delivers Better ROI?
✅ Google Ads Delivers Better ROI When:
-
You offer high-intent services
-
Customers search for your solution
-
You want faster conversions
-
You target local searches like “near me”
Best for:
Service businesses, agencies, local services, B2B, emergency or urgent needs.
✅ Facebook Ads Delivers Better ROI When:
-
You want to build brand awareness
-
Your product needs education or storytelling
-
You rely on retargeting
-
You want lower cost per lead initially
Best for:
E-commerce, coaching, education, lifestyle brands, startups.

The Best Strategy: Use Google Ads + Facebook Ads Together
The highest ROI usually comes from combining both platforms.
Smart Funnel Strategy:
-
Google Ads → Capture high-intent leads
-
Facebook Ads → Retarget visitors & nurture trust
-
Automation (WhatsApp / Email) → Convert leads faster
This multi-channel approach lowers overall acquisition cost and increases ROI.
